In 2017 APCO Worldwide deployed Oracle NetSuite ERP OneWorld as its ERP Financial platform. The OneWorld implementation was provisioned as a single cloud instance to support more than 30 legal entities and a global user base exceeding 700 users, with finance operations staffed by over 50 finance team members. Oracle NetSuite ERP was configured with core ERP Financial capability sets including general ledger, accounts payable, accounts receivable, multi currency processing, intercompany accounting and consolidated financial reporting. Configuration emphasized multi entity ledgers, intercompany transaction orchestration and role based access controls to enable centralized financial close workflows and period end reconciliation. The implementation applied a normalized chart of accounts and subsidiary level segment structures consistent with OneWorld multi subsidiary design. Project responsibilities included go live support and ongoing stabilization to address post go live configuration tuning, user acceptance issues and process stabilization across finance and accounting teams. Governance centered on a centralized rollout model with finance process standardization and change management for the more than 50 finance staff, while operational support covered the broader 700 user population. Oracle NetSuite ERP OneWorld was implemented as a consolidated SaaS architecture to provide unified cross entity reporting and controlled subsidiary transaction autonomy.

In 2016, APCO Worldwide deployed OnitX ELM as its Legal Practice Management application. The OnitX ELM instance is provisioned on APCO's public Onit site and is accessible through APCO's Onit user portal at https://apco.onit.com/users/sign_in, indicating a web accessible platform supporting the firm’s legal operations. OnitX ELM was configured to provide core Legal Practice Management capabilities including centralized matter intake, matter lifecycle management, document repository and versioning, automated approval workflows, and matter level reporting and audit trails. The configuration emphasizes workflow orchestration and process standardization common to legal operations, with templates and rules applied to intake and approval paths. Operational coverage centers on APCO’s corporate legal and compliance functions, with administration centralized under legal operations. Access is managed through role based permissions inside the OnitX ELM environment, and user interaction is delivered via the APCO Onit portal which exposes matter management, document access, and workflow tasks to authorized internal users.

In 2015 APCO Worldwide implemented Microsoft 365, deploying the Microsoft 365 collaboration suite across its professional services organization. The implementation placed Microsoft 365 at the center of APCO Worldwide's Collaboration strategy, consolidating email, document collaboration, team communication, and knowledge management capabilities to support internal communications and client-facing collaboration workflows. The deployment leveraged cloud-hosted Collaboration capabilities typical of Microsoft 365, including email and calendaring, team chat and meetings, document libraries and file sync, and centralized content management. APCO Worldwide's public website contains references to Microsoft 365 components, indicating that Microsoft 365 artifacts and content publishing workflows are surfaced externally and integrated with the firm’s digital presence, while operational governance focused on tenant administration, information architecture, and user provisioning across corporate communications and client service teams.

APCO Worldwide is a Professional Services organization based in United States, with around 680 employees and annual revenues of $257.0 million.
APCO Worldwide operates a diverse technology stack with applications such as Oracle NetSuite ERP, OnitX ELM and Microsoft 365, covering areas like ERP Financial, Legal Practice Management and Collaboration.
APCO Worldwide has invested in cloud applications and AI-driven platforms to optimize efficiency and growth, collaborating with vendors such as Oracle, Onit and Microsoft.
APCO Worldwide recently adopted applications including CodeTwo Email Signatures in 2021, Deltek Maconomy in 2020 and Cloudflare CDN in 2020, highlighting its ongoing modernization strategy.
